PackageDescriptionDevelopment files for kscreenlocker KDE systemsettings module to configure kscreenlocker. . kscreenlocker can be configured to support the PAM ("Pluggable Authentication Modules") system for password checking (for unlocking the display). . PAM is a flexible application-transparent configurable user-authentication system found on FreeBSD, Solaris, and Linux (and maybe other unixes). . Information about PAM may be found on its homepage http://www.kernel.org/pub/linux/libs/pam/ (Despite the location, this information is NOT Linux-specific.) . This package contains development files for kscreenlocker.
